March 2024 by Suzette S.
If you are a book lover, this is heaven! This is an old house in the German Village turned into a huge bookstore! They use every room, hallway, closet, and even under the staircases to cover the walls with bookshelves. I had to be quick on this trip, so the signs labeling genres in rooms were very helpful! I was able to find a book I've been looking for and even a newer book I hadn't heard of for a great price. Many books are labeled 5% off the price or specially priced at $5.99-$10. There are large areas of children books, young adult books, and every genre you can think of. When you arrive, you walk through the side gate, through a narrow garden area. There are benches to enjoy on a beautiful day. It's not a extremely close to the German style restaurants, but a definite place to visit in the area

October 2023 by Kate Swafford
This is a quaint, cozy, but also deceptively large independent bookstore - a multi-story fever dream of cubbies, nooks, stairs, puzzles, games, trinkets, souvenirs, and obviously shelves upon shelves of thankfully well-labeled books. It is so easy to get lost in there, they have a printed map you can take with you! They also (and I cannot stress enough how unreasonably gleeful it made me when I found these) have a selection of working cuckoo clocks!!!! ?I don't recommend this place for people with mobility issues, as there are far too many steps to make it wheelchair-accessible and a steep, uneven brick path up to the door. However, for everybody who doesn't mind steps, stairs, tiny cubbies and narrow passages, this is a bibliophile's dream! There are also benches outside along the enclosed brick pathway for you to recover your equilibrium from being lost in the book maze, before you emerge back into the real world. ?Well worth the trip! ??

July 2023 by Will Dorrell
Go here. This place is amazing. Photos will not show how absolutely jam-packed this place is with shelves of books that form a delightful maze of narrow halls and surprise staircases.They have 32 rooms crammed into a long house in the German village with each room, roughly, containing a genre of book. Some rooms are bigger than others, like the kids section, or the fantasy and scify area. Go early if it's a weekend because they will start metering entry when it gets too busy. There are books spilling out onto the ally, though, so there are still tables to look through outside. Just a minor warning: you will get cozy with everyone in the store as you squeeze past each other. Still, go here. It's an absolute banger of a bookstore.
